Kazakhstan - Greenhouse Gas Emissions from the Energy Sector

Since 2014, Kazakhstan Greenhouse Gas Emissions from the Energy Sector rose 2.7% year on year. At 334,051.22 Thousand Metric Tons of CO2 Equivalent in 2019, the country was ranked number 13 comparing other countries in Greenhouse Gas Emissions from the Energy Sector. Kazakhstan is overtaken by Italy, which was number 12 with 337,464.09 Thousand Metric Tons of CO2 Equivalent and is followed by France at 316,950.01 Thousand Metric Tons of CO2 Equivalent. United States ranked the highest with 5,465,486.43 Thousand Metric Tons of CO2 Equivalent in 2019, that is a decrease of 1.5% compared to 2018. Russia, Japan and Germany resp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Chile recorded the best 5 years average growth at +3.5% per year, while Malta was the worst growing country at -10.3% per year.
